    Excerpt
    Sen. Anna Theresia “Risa” Hontiveros, whose Akbayan party-list group was among the first to consistently call out China for its muscling tactics at the West Philippine Sea, on Sunday hailed the arbitral ruling of The Hague-based tribunal 10 years ago. At the same time, Sen. Erwin Tulfo pushed for early passage of a bill mandating the teaching of the West Philippine Sea issues in classrooms, after Chinese scholars called the island province of Batanes, a “natural geographical extension” of Taiwan.
